What Are the Powertrain Options for the 2026 Honda City?

The 2026 Honda City is offered with two powertrain choices: a petrol engine and a hybrid e:HEV system. The petrol version uses a 1.5L DOHC i-VTEC engine paired with a CVT, producing 121 PS (~89 kW) and 145 Nm. The hybrid model uses a 1.5L e:HEV powertrain with an Electronic CVT, producing 109 PS (~80 kW) and 253 Nm.

The hybrid powertrain delivers significantly higher torque at 253 Nm compared to the petrol's 145 Nm, indicating a focus on low-end responsiveness and efficiency. Honda Malaysia has not yet disclosed official fuel economy figures for either variant in the booking announcement.

What Design Changes Does the 2026 Honda City Facelift Include?

The 2026 Honda City represents a more extensive facelift than the previous model update, featuring a narrower grille and slimmer LED headlights. A long integrated light bar provides a cleaner and sleeker appearance compared to the bulging grille design of the prior model. These exterior changes modernize the vehicle's visual identity.

According to the announcement, this facelift is described as "a bigger facelift than before," signaling more substantial styling revisions than the 2023 model update. The design shift moves away from the prominent front grille toward a more streamlined, contemporary look.

What Safety and Driver Assistance Features Are Available?

The 2026 Honda City includes a new Multi-View Camera System, which is Honda's term for its 360-degree view camera. This system is paired with blind spot information, a cross traffic monitoring system, and the full Honda Sensing suite of safety features. The safety package is comprehensive for the compact sedan segment.

The Honda Sensing suite includes lane departure warning, road departure mitigation, lane keep assist, forward collision warning, collision mitigation braking, auto high beam, adaptive cruise control, and lead car departure notification. A low speed follow function is also available, but it is exclusive to the e:HEV RS model.

What Is the Pre-Booking Campaign for the 2026 Honda City?

Honda Malaysia has not revealed the prices of the new City but has launched a pre-booking campaign with an Early Bird Reward. Customers who book by 30 September are offered a RM3,000 Early Bird Reward. Bookings can be made through the dedicated pre-booking page at prebook.honda.com.my or at authorized dealerships nationwide.

For the hybrid model specifically, Honda Malaysia is promising a 10-year and unlimited mileage warranty for its hybrid battery and components. This warranty offer is a key differentiator for the hybrid variant and addresses potential consumer concerns about long-term battery reliability.
